TOEFL Exam

TOEFL, or the Test of English as a Foreign Language, is a standardized exam that evaluates the English skills of non-native speakers. Accepted by universities worldwide, it is often a requirement for academic and professional courses. Developed and conducted by ETS, the TOEFL exam can be understood through these six key points:

    Key Information About TOEFL Exam
    Feature Description
    Purpose Evaluates your English proficiency for academic and professional courses.
    Administered by ETS (Educational Testing Service)
    Acceptance Accepted by more than 13,000 institutions in 200+ countries.
    Test Duration Around 2 hours (for TOEFL iBT).
    Test Formats Available at test centres or online at home.
    Registration Online through the ETS website. Choose a date 2-3 months before deadlines.
    Fees Varies by location. Extra charges apply for rescheduling or additional score reports.

    TOEFL Exam Types

    TOEFL Exam Type Description
    TOEFL iBT (Internet-Based Test) Conducted online at test centers or at home. Has four sections: Reading, Writing, Listening, and Speaking.
    TOEFL PBT (Paper-Based Test) Previously available in areas without internet access. It had Reading, Writing, and Listening sections (No Speaking). Discontinued on April 11, 2022. Scores are valid for two years.
    TOEFL Essentials A shorter version of TOEFL iBT (1.5 hours). Includes an optional Personal Statement video, which is not scored but helps institutions know the candidate better. Can be taken at home.
    TOEFL Primary For young learners (ages 8+) to build foundational English skills.
    TOEFL Junior For students aged 11+ to evaluate their academic English proficiency.
    TOEFL ITP For students aged 16+ for institutions to evaluate academic English levels.

    TOEFL iBT Exam Sections and Timings

    Section Time Number of Questions / Tasks What It Tests
    Reading 35 min 20 questions Understanding academic texts.
    Listening 36 min 28 questions Understanding lectures and conversations.
    Speaking 16 min 4 tasks Clear and effective communication.
    Writing 29 min 2 tasks Organized and structured responses.

    What is TOEFL Test on Paper?

    The TOEFL Test on Paper was an alternative to the TOEFL iBT, created for regions without internet access. However, ETS has now discontinued this option, and it is no longer available.

    TOEFL Exam Formats

    Format Description
    At Test Centers Conducted at authorized locations worldwide.
    At Home (TOEFL iBT Home Edition) Available 24 hours a day, 4 days a week.

    TOEFL Exam Fees in India 2025

    TOEFL Standard Registration Fees
    Test Format Fee (INR) Fee (USD)
    TOEFL iBT (Internet-Based Test) INR 16,900 USD 205
    TOEFL iBT Home Edition INR 16,900 USD 205
    TOEFL Essentials Test INR 9,996.78 USD 120
    TOEFL Additional Fees
    Service Fee (INR) Fee (USD)
    Late Registration INR 3,900 USD 40
    Test Rescheduling INR 5,900 USD 60
    Reinstatement of Canceled Scores INR 1,990 USD 20
    Additional Score Reports (per report) INR 1,950 USD 25
    Speaking or Writing Section Score Review INR 7,900 USD 80
    Speaking and Writing Section Score Review INR 13,835 USD 160
    Payment Return (for declined payments) INR 2,900 USD 30

    Which Popular Universities Accept the TOEFL Score?

    Top Universities that accept TOEFL scores TOEFL iBT Minimum Requirement
    University of British Columbia (Canada) 90 overall (Reading and Listening: at least 22, Writing and Speaking: at least 21)
    University of Winnipeg (Canada) 86 overall (at least 20 in each section)
    Seneca College (Canada) 84 overall
    ESSEC Business School (France) 100 overall
    Erasmus University (Netherlands) 100 overall (at least 20 in each section)
    University of Amsterdam (Undergraduate) 92 overall (at least 22 in each section)
    University of Arizona (Graduate) 100 overall (Reading: 24, Listening: 22, Speaking: 25, Writing: 24)
    University of Arizona (Graduate) 79 overall
    University of Arizona (Undergraduate) 70 overall (competitive programs require at least 79)
    University of California, Berkeley (Graduate) 90 overall
    University of Colorado Boulder (Undergraduate) 75 overall (Writing: at least 19)
    University of Maryland (Undergraduate) 95 overall
    University of Maryland (Graduate) 96 overall (Reading: 26, Listening: 24, Speaking: 22, Writing: 24)

    TOEFL Exam Eligibility Criteria 2025

    There are no specific eligibility criteria for the TOEFL exam. Anyone can take it, whether for academic purposes or to assess their English proficiency. There is also no age limit.

    Important Dates for the TOEFL Exam 2025

    The TOEFL iBT exam is offered throughout the year, over 60 times annually. The TOEFL Home Edition is available 24/7, with appointments possible just 24 hours after registration.

    TOEFL Score Range 2025

    Each section is scored on a scale of 30 points.

    Sections added together form a total score range of 0-120.

    Skill Level
    Listening Section
  • Advanced (22–30)
  • High-Intermediate (17–21)
  • Low-Intermediate (9–16)
  • Below Low-Intermediate (0–8)
  • Reading Section
  • Advanced (24–30)
  • High-Intermediate (18–23)
  • Low-Intermediate (4–17)
  • Below Low-Intermediate (0–3)
  • Writing Section
  • Advanced (24–30)
  • High-Intermediate (17–23)
  • Low-Intermediate (13–16)
  • Basic (7–12)
  • Below Basic (0–6)
  • Speaking Section
  • Advanced (25–30)
  • High-Intermediate (20–24)
  • Low-Intermediate (16–19)
  • Basic (10–15)
  • Below Basic (0–9)
  • Top Preparation Tips for the TOEFL Exam 2025

    Understand the Exam Format

    4 sections: Reading, Listening, Speaking, Writing.

    Take timed mock tests to get familiar with the structure.

    Improve Reading

    Read academic articles and news (BBC, The New York Times).

    Focus on identifying main ideas, details, and paraphrasing.

    Enhance Listening Skills

    Listen to TED Talks, BBC, and NPR podcasts.

    Practice taking quick notes while listening.

    Strengthen Speaking

    Practice giving structured responses.

    Record yourself to improve pronunciation and fluency.

    Take Mock Tests

    Use official ETS practice tests.

    Analyze mistakes and work on weak areas.

    Manage Time Effectively

    Reading: 1 minute per question.

    Listening: Take brief notes.

    Speaking: 15 seconds to prepare answers.

    Writing: Spend 5 minutes planning your essay.

    Prepare for Test Day

    Arrive 30 minutes early.

    Check system requirements (for Home Edition).

    Carry a valid ID and your ETS confirmation.

    Stay Confident & Relaxed

    Get enough sleep and stay hydrated.

    Trust your preparation!
